Can NVIDIA RTX 6000 Ada run Microsoft Phi 3.5 Vision Instruct?

Microsoft Phi 3.5 Vision Instruct speed on NVIDIA RTX 6000 Ada and quantization-level VRAM fit.

Runs Q448GB VRAM availableRequires 2GB+

NVIDIA RTX 6000 Ada meets the minimum VRAM requirement for Q4 inference of Microsoft Phi 3.5 Vision Instruct. Review the quantization breakdown below to see how higher precision settings impact VRAM and throughput.

Short answer: NVIDIA RTX 6000 Ada can run Microsoft Phi 3.5 Vision Instruct at Q4 with an estimated 214 tok/s.
Estimated speed
214 tok/s
VRAM needed
2GB
VRAM headroom
+46GB

What this means for you

NVIDIA RTX 6000 Ada can run Microsoft Phi 3.5 Vision Instruct with Q4 quantization. At approximately 214 tokens/second, you can expect Excellent speed - conversational response times under 1 second.

You have 46GB headroom, which is sufficient for system overhead and smooth operation.

Quantization breakdown

QuantizationVRAM neededVRAM availableEstimated speedVerdict
Q42GB48GB214.19 tok/s✅ Fits comfortably
Q83GB48GB149.93 tok/s✅ Fits comfortably
FP166GB48GB81.39 tok/s✅ Fits comfortably
